## Formula sandbox tuning

User-supplied formulas in Gridmoor execute inside a restricted interpreter with hard ceilings on time, memory, and call depth. Reviewers should confirm any change to these ceilings is justified in the PR description, since raising them widens the abuse surface. Defaults were chosen from production traces. The current limits are as follows.

limits module of tafog-fawip:
WEIGHTS = {
    "julix": 57,
    "lamys": 992,
    "kasvan": 209,
    "quenok": 750,
    "alddor": 259,
    "oliath": 1009,
    "wenix": 815,
}

## TaxRate Lookup Cache (Quillbook Internal API)

The cache holds jurisdiction tax rates for 24 hours. If a customer reports a wrong rate after a regional update, the cache is likely stale. Support can force a refresh via `POST /internal/taxcache/flush` with the region code. Flushes are logged and rate-limited to one per region per hour. Authenticate the flush request with the internal key below.

gateway credential: kto23_LX9A4ys6i4nzHtpOLNLodKK

// Fan-out constants for the Squallpipe alert dispatcher.
// Plugin authors: your handler is invoked once per subscriber shard,
// not once per alert. Retries are at the shard level; idempotency is
// on you. Severe-weather bursts (see the Harlow Basin incident) can
// multiply fan-out 20x within a minute, so the dispatcher throttles
// per-plugin concurrency and drops stale alerts past the TTL rather
// than queueing them. Do not mutate these values at runtime; they are
// read once at plugin load. Current tuning constants follow.

tuning table, bagug-hadug:
WEIGHTS = {
    "pelok": 479,
    "holael": 394,
    "ulaox": 233,
    "sildor": 187,
    "ulaax": 579,
    "ulaix": 24,
    "fraath": 900,
}

Quick note before you cut the Veltrix release: the validator plugin loader now checks signatures at startup, so every plugin bundle needs the signing secret available in the env. Nothing fancy — just make sure staging and prod both have it before you flip the feature flag, or the loader will refuse every plugin and the pipeline stalls. Add the following line to the release env file.

env line for yajep-bajof: ARCHIVE_KEY3=015